the future of precision control: hydrogen energy electric single seat regulating valve

As industries and technologies evolve, the need for precise control mechanisms in energy systems becomes increasingly vital. Among the emerging technologies, the Hydrogen Energy Electric Single Seat Regulating Valve stands out as a crucial component, particularly in the field of hydrogen energy. This innovative valve is designed to manage and regulate the flow of hydrogen with exceptional accuracy, ensuring efficiency and safety in various applications.

Hydrogen energy is gaining traction as a clean and sustainable alternative to traditional fossil fuels. Its potential for reducing greenhouse gas emissions and providing a renewable energy source is unparalleled. However, the efficient use of hydrogen requires advanced control systems to handle its unique properties. The Hydrogen Energy Electric Single Seat Regulating Valve addresses this need by offering precise control over hydrogen flow, which is essential for maintaining system stability and performance. This valve is characterized by its single-seat design, which allows for a more compact and streamlined structure compared to traditional multi-seat valves. The single-seat design minimizes turbulence and energy loss, making it highly efficient for regulating hydrogen flow. It is particularly useful in applications where space is limited, and where precise control is crucial for maintaining optimal system performance.
